ALEXANDRIA, Va., June 4 -- United States Patent no. 12,317,960, issued on June 3, was assigned to NIKE Inc. (Beaverton, Ore.).

"Rear access article of footwear with movable heel portion" was invented by Tinker L. Hatfield (Portland, Ore.), Tiffany A. Beers (Portland, Ore.), John T. Dimoff (Portland, Ore.), Jared M. Kilmer (Vancouver, Wash.) and Kevin J. Rucier (Portland, Ore.).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"An article of footwear comprises a sole structure, and an upper including a front section and a rear section.
